Assembling the Christmas Cookie Tree
This section details the step-by-step process for building your Christmas cookie tree. Carefully follow each step for a perfect outcome.
- Begin by carefully unboxing the kit and gathering all the necessary components. The kit should contain everything you need, including pre-cut cookie shapes, icing, and decorations.
- Carefully place the pre-cut cookie shapes on a baking sheet, ensuring they are not touching each other. This allows for proper baking and prevents sticking.
- Bake the cookies according to the instructions provided in the kit. Over-baking can result in hard cookies, so closely monitor the baking time. Using a timer is a useful tool.
- Allow the cookies to cool completely before attempting to assemble the tree. This prevents them from crumbling and ensures a stable structure.
- Once the cookies are completely cool, use a small amount of icing to attach the cookies to the base of the pre-made tree structure. This should be applied to the back of each cookie for secure placement.
- Gradually add more cookies, working your way up the tree. Start with the larger cookies at the bottom and add smaller ones as you move higher.
- Use a toothpick or a small knife to carefully insert the cookies, and ensure each one is placed securely.

Alternative Cookie Bases
Beyond the provided cookie dough, there are diverse alternatives. Pre-made sugar cookies, purchased from a bakery, offer a convenient starting point, saving time and effort while still achieving a festive result. Consider gingerbread cookies for a warm, spiced flavor, or even decorated chocolate sandwich cookies for a more decadent touch. The key is to select a cookie that holds its shape well, allowing for easy decoration.

Specific Thematic Ideas
Transform your Christmas cookie tree into a miniature winter wonderland, a vibrant candy cane forest, or a magical North Pole scene. For a winter wonderland theme, use shades of white, silver, and blue icing. Sprinkle snowflakes and tiny edible glitter on the tree branches. For a candy cane forest, use red and white icing, and incorporate miniature candy canes and peppermint candies.
A North Pole scene can feature icing in shades of red, green, and white, with tiny figurines of Santa Claus and reindeer. These thematic ideas can help guide your creativity and ensure a cohesive and impactful display.
